  • Abstract
    This paper proposes a methodology for identifying a major electromagnetic radiation noise source from mother boards used in computers. The key idea is based on a combination of the discretized Helmholtz theorem and minimum norm strategy. Application of our methodology clarifies that the rotational current distributions work as one of the loop antennas. Thus, we have succeeded in identifying a major noise cause of the mother boards
